Yeah, have had some good nips before, and red marks. But not flowing blood like this time. I think I will start wearing gloves, though. But with the teeth on this moma, probably bite through them as well.

BTW, she regularly lays eggs on the rocks even though there is no male, and guards them. Obviously they don't survive, and are gone in a couple days. Might have been eggs there somewhere today, but didn't see them. She was definitely extra viscous today.

Amazingly, no battles with the other fish,... just doesn't like me. Guess they all know to stay away from her.
